Aus dem Kurs: Rekursion und rekursive Funktionen in Python
So erhalten Sie Zugriff auf diesen Kurs
Werden Sie noch heute Mitglied und erhalten Sie Zugriff auf mehr als 24.900 Kurse von Branchenfachleuten.
Fibonacci-Zahlen berechnen – Tutorial zu Python
Aus dem Kurs: Rekursion und rekursive Funktionen in Python
Fibonacci-Zahlen berechnen
Ein Algorithmus, der sich wunderbar für den Einsatz von Rekursion anbietet, ist die Berechnung der Fibonacci-Zahlen. Allerdings werden wir in diesem Video sowohl einen rekursiven Ansatz bzw. mehrere rekursive Ansätze sehen, als auch einen iterativen Ansatz. Doch was sind die Fibonacci-Zahlen? Die Fibonacci-Zahlen sind genauer genommen eine sog. Reihe von Zahlen. 0 ist die erste Zahl, 1 die zweite Zahl, diese beiden Zahlen sind vorgegeben. Alle weiteren Zahlen ergeben sich immer aus der Summe der jeweiligen beiden Vorgänger. 0 und 1 gibt 1, dann 1 und 1 gibt 2, 1 und 2 gibt 3 und so fort. Nun möchte ich Ihnen zuerst einmal einen iterativen Ansatz zeigen, wie man diese Fibonacci-Zahlen berechnen kann. Zuerst einmal fordere ich auf, dass eingegeben wird, wie viele Zahlen der Fibonacci-Reihe bestimmt werden sollen, bspw. 10, und dann werden diese ausgegeben. Wie wir besprochen haben, die erste Zahl ist 0, dann kommt 1, 1 und 0 gibt wieder 1, 1 und 1 gibt 2, 1 und 2 gibt 3 und so fort. Nun…
Inhalt
-
-
-
-
(Gesperrt)
Größter gemeinsamer Teiler (ggT)5 Min. 23 Sek.
-
(Gesperrt)
Fibonacci-Zahlen berechnen6 Min. 15 Sek.
-
(Gesperrt)
Fakultät einer Zahl bestimmen4 Min. 9 Sek.
-
(Gesperrt)
Maximum und Minimum bestimmen5 Min. 50 Sek.
-
(Gesperrt)
Gaußsche Summe berechnen5 Min. 25 Sek.
-
(Gesperrt)
Potenzrechnung4 Min. 49 Sek.
-
(Gesperrt)
Dezimalzahl in Binärzahl5 Min. 28 Sek.
-
(Gesperrt)
-
-
-